Description

A lively assortment of witty sketches and amusing anecdotes, this volume invites listeners into an odd corner of everyday life where the mundane is turned on its head. The author’s sharp eye catches the absurdities hidden in ordinary moments—whether it’s a mis‑typed scientific fact turned into a playful pun or a poetic line transformed into a comical scene. The humor is bolstered by nearly four hundred illustrations that echo the text’s cleverness, giving each tale a visual punchline that enhances the listening experience.

Beyond the laugh‑out‑loud moments, the work offers a gentle reflection on the role of fun in society, suggesting that merriment can defuse malice and brighten the mind. The preface assures readers that many stories are fresh, while a few familiar sketches have been lovingly refined. Listeners will find a charming blend of satire, wordplay, and good‑natured observation that makes ordinary life feel delightfully extraordinary.

About the author

Charles Heber Clark

Charles Heber Clark

1841–1915

Best known by the pen name Max Adeler, this 19th-century American humorist mixed newsroom wit with small-town storytelling. His comic writing made him widely popular in his day, especially after the success of Out of the Hurly-Burly.
